2. UN Comtrade Global Battery & Display Baseline (HS 850760 / 8524)
| HS Code | Product Scope | 2023 Export Value | 2024 Export Value | YoY Growth |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| HS 850760 | Lithium-ion accumulators (cells & packs) | $65.006B | $61.127B | -5.97% |
| HS 8524 | Flat panel display modules (LCD / OLED) | $38.761B | $45.273B | +16.8% |
| HS 8528 | Monitors, projectors & commercial display devices | $32.374B | $35.513B | +9.7% |
3. Mandatory Dangerous Goods, Emission & International Approval Matrix
| Regulatory Area | Governing Framework | Core Technical Mandates | Buyer Verification Action |
|---|---|---|---|
| Dangerous Transport | UN 38.3 & Customs Dangerous Goods Package | Thermal, shock, vibration, short circuit tests; dangerous packaging cert | Verify model-specific UN 38.3 test summary and valid dangerous goods packaging certificate |
| EU Battery Law | Regulation (EU) 2023/1542 | Mandatory CE marking, capacity labeling, and digital battery passport | Ensure technical files and EU conformity declarations align with new battery regulations |
| Display Energy Label | Regulation (EU) 2019/2013 & EPREL | Mandatory energy efficiency labels and EU EPREL product registration | Confirm product registration in the EU EPREL database before commercial distribution |
| United States | US FCC Title 47 | RF emission and wireless compliance for smart display devices | Audit FCC equipment authorization and SDoC documentation |

❓ What manufacturing cluster scale and supply chain dominance establish Huizhou as China's battery and display powerhouse?
Official statistical communiqués and municipal reports confirm: ① Ultra-HD Display 100B+ RMB Cluster: In 2025, Huizhou's Ultra-HD video display industry surpassed 111.63B RMB in industrial output (+11.3% YoY), covering glass substrates, panels, modules, and complete smart TVs; ② Zhongkai Manufacturing Powerhouse: In 2024, Zhongkai produced 971.43M lithium-ion batteries (~60% of Huizhou's total output, 68.38B RMB energy electronics output across 90+ large enterprises including EVE Energy and Desay Battery), 300.06M LCD display panels (+11.7%), 9.51M LCD modules (+41.2%), and 34.31M TV sets; ③ Huiyang Industrial Extension: Huiyang electronic information output reached 106.8B RMB, featuring display cover glass leaders like Biel Crystal, driving 44.99B RMB in total 2025 exports.

❓ What mandatory safety, hazardous transport, and environmental regulations govern battery and display exports?
① Hazardous Goods Transport: Mandatory UN 38.3 test summary and Customs Dangerous Goods Packaging Inspection (Performance & Use Inspection) conforming to IATA DGR 66th Edition; ② EU Battery Regulation: Full compliance with Regulation (EU) 2023/1542 (CE labeling, capacity marks, EPR, and digital battery passport roadmap); ③ Display Energy Ratings: Compliance with EU Energy Label Regulation (EU) 2019/2013 and mandatory EPREL product registration; ④ EU GPSR & US FCC: General Product Safety Regulation (EU 2023/988) EU Responsible Person mandates and US FCC Title 47 RF compliance.
